The National Strategic Food Price Information Center recorded an average daily price of large red chilies (per kg) in modern markets across several provinces at Rp. 77,410 per kg, as of Tuesday, December 3, 2024. Overall, the average this week decreased compared to the previous week's average of Rp. 77,850 per kg.

The daily price of large red chilies in modern markets in Jambi was the most expensive in Indonesia, with a selling price of Rp. 139,900 per kg. Compared to a month ago, the price of large red chilies in this province has not changed. The highest selling price ever recorded in this region is Rp. 139,900 per kg.

Meanwhile, in modern markets in East Kalimantan, large red chilies were sold at Rp. 139,300 per kg, making it the second most expensive in the country.

Then, in third place, the price of large red chilies in South Kalimantan was Rp. 119,900 per kg, Riau Rp. 115,950 per kg, and Southeast Sulawesi Rp. 106,900 per kg.

Meanwhile, there are 14 provinces with large red chili sales below the national average. The three provinces with the lowest selling prices for large red chilies are Bali, West Sulawesi, and South Sulawesi.
